The Taurus Tunable Filter (TTF) has now been in regular use for seven years on the Anglo-Australian Telescope (AAT). The instrument was also used for three years (1996-1999) on the William Herschel Telescope (WHT). We present a brief review of the different applications in order to illustrate the versatility of tunable filters in optical/IR spectrophotometric imaging. Tunable filters are now either planned or under development for 6-10 m class telescopes which ensures their use for years to come.
